Unable to Sync after update to IOS 13.1.3

I have a Garmin Edge Explore and after upgrading my iPhone to ios 13.1.3 the Garmin is not automatically uploading to Garmin Connect anymore. Also manual upload does not work properly.

I have set the settings of the iPhone to the suggested settings but nothing works.

Garmin Connect app shows a green bullet to indicate it is connected to Edge Explore, but trying to sync is resulting in a red triangle indicating an error.

I use an iPhone X with ios 13.1.3

The Garmin Explore is on software version 4.24.0.17

  • G'day folks

    I had a similar issue to that described above and found no amount of fu'ing around forgetting and deleting bluetooth pairings would help. In desperation I added Garmin Connect to the work phone that runs Android and tried synching an activity to Garmin Connect. Garmin and the Android phone thought and discussed this for quite a while between themselves and finally synched an activity. SUCCESS! When I un-paired the Android phone and re-paired my iPhone SE, the Garmin device (Edge 810) now downloads to the iPhone.  Personally I suspect somehow that the Android phone and the Edge device fixed the issue in Garmins software.  Bluetooth always connected to the iPhone SE but the Garmin device would not download throwing an error. Livetrack on the Garmin always worked fine which makes me suspect it wasnt the bluetooth as such but the script that communicates activities to the phone.  I hope this helps someone. Dont ask how or why it worked...it just did for me.
